Canada's most recent all-program Express Entry draw was held on November 23. Since the start of express entry all-program draws from July 6, this is the ninth draw after hiatus. 4,750 profiles were invited to apply for permanent residency through the Express Entry Draw (PR). Invitations were sent to applicants with a Comprehensive Ranking System (CRS) score of 491 or higher.
Comparing the CRS cut-off score to the Express Entry draw on November 9, 2022, just 3 points have been dropped. Additionally, a number of invitations were carried over from the last draw. This year's Express Entry draw is the eleventh overall.
All program Express Entry drawings include all Express Entry profiles under the Federal Skilled Worker Program (FSWP), Canadian Experience Class (CEC), and Federal Skilled Trades (FST). It also takes into account profiles that fall under any of the aforementioned categories and have received a provincial nomination.

Express Entry drawings for all programs were suspended for more than 18 months in December 2020. Due to COVID-19, there were many travel restrictions that were implied in the 2020 pandemic era, so the express entry all program draws were put on hold. Only those people from the Canadian Experience Class (CEC) or Provincial Nominee Program (PNP) received invitations to apply (ITAs) at this time. However, the IRCC also stopped doing lotteries for the CEC in September 2021.
Processing time for Express Entry for the month of November, 2022
Provincial Nominee Program (PNP) (through Express Entry) - 14 months
Canadian Experience Class - 19 months
Federal Skilled Worker Program - 27 months
Federal Skilled Trades Program - 49 months
Express Entry Upcoming Changes in 2023
In 2023, Express Entry is likely to change. Candidates can anticipate that Express Entry draws will continue into late 2022 and early 2023, and that CRS scores will be the primary determining factor in issuing ITAs.
But starting in 2023, the IRCC will have the ability to conduct targeted drawings thanks to the newly passed Bill C-19. Depending on Canada's most immediate economic need, the requirements for receiving an ITA may change between draws.
An individual might be granted an ITA, for instance, depending on their line of work, level of education, or language proficiency. According to Sean Fraser, Minister of Immigration, these focused draws would better position new permanent residents on a path to success while also ensuring that critical workforce shortfalls in Canada are met.
NOC Updates
On November 16, IRCC announced NOC 2021, an update to NOC 2016, the National Occupation Classification (NOC) system that is used to identify the occupation and level of expertise of an Express Entry candidate.
Based on the training, education, experience, and responsibility (TEER) required, the new method classifies vocations. The NOC 2016 skill levels 0-E have been revised by the new TEER system, which also produced the equivalent of five TEERS.
NOC 2016 | NOC 2021 |
Skill Type 0 | TEER 0 |
Skill Type A | TEER 1 |
Skill Type B | TEER 2 |
Skill Type B | TEER 3 |
Skill Type C | TEER 4 |
Skill Type D | TEER 5 |
16 new occupations have been eligible for Express Entry as a result of the implementation of the TEER system, while three occupations have lost their eligibility. The prohibited professions might nevertheless be acceptable under different legal routes for economic immigration, like provincial nominee schemes.
Target industries for the new jobs include tech, healthcare, and truck driving, all of which are already suffering from a lack of trained labour in Canada.
Following are the occupations that become eligible under TEER system in Express Entry
Aircraft assemblers and aircraft assembly inspectors
Bus drivers, subway operators, and other transit operators
By-law enforcement and other regulatory officers
Correctional service officers
Dental assistants and dental laboratory assistants
Elementary and secondary school teacher assistants
Estheticians, electrologists, and related occupations
Heavy equipment operators
Nurse aides, orderlies, and patient service associates
Other repairers and servicers
Payroll administrators
Pest controllers and fumigators
Pharmacy technical assistants and pharmacy assistants
Residential and commercial installers and servicers
Sheriffs and bailiffs
Transport truck drivers

What is the express entry system?
The 2015 Express Entry system was created with the goal of streamlining and enhancing the Canadian immigration procedure. It has been quite effective in drastically cutting down processing time. The Federal Skilled Worker Program, Skilled Trades Program, and the Canadian Experience Class are Canada's three Federal Economic Immigration programmes. The Express Entry system administers the pool of candidates for these programmes rather than being an immigration programme in and of itself.
The Comprehensive Ranking System (CRS), a point system based on factors like age, education, and work experience, assigns applicants a ranking based on their overall performance. Every two weeks, there are Express Entry drawings when candidates are placed against one another and offered to permanently settle in Canada based on their CRS score.
